Questions & Answers: Blueberry Plants In Containers

Wednesday, January 7th, 2009

“Hi,

I got a blueberry plant for Christmas and was hoping to buy a second plant to cross-pollinate. However, I live in an apartment and have
very limited space, so I need to grow in containers. I was wondering what size container you would recommend for your bare root blueberry
varieties
? I can repot later on, but how much growth would you expect in the first year?

Thanks!
Simone”

Hi Simone,

Here’s some good planting info for container blueberries:

http://www.davewilson.com/homegrown/promotion/bluecontainer.html

You’d start in a 2 to 5 Gallon container, then transplant into a 16 to 20 inch.  I’d estimate that you’d get 6-8 inches of growth per year.  They reach mature height after about six years, usually reaching six feet high and wide, but in a container probably smaller (maybe four feet).  You can, however, prune them to whatever size you want.
